A few of you know, I'm starting to work on Iffo's 'adult' model (although I'm a couple of months away from making the switch)

Due to the Borneck in him, he should actually be quite broad. Does anyone know of any models that I can either frankenstein together or re-skin completely? That will allow him to be broader, the HS_Anakin model and most of the base models are all super skinny.

I looked at the Noghri model, which is good except for the head part of the model, and when you frankenstein a human head on, it doesn't sit right a top it.. so that's not really option.

Just thought I'd post to see if anyone had any ideas or knew of anything!

Fortunately Iffo has made the switch from blender to 3DS Max! Unfortunately, I'm not sure there's an easy way of doing this while keeping all of the proportions intact.

I would suggest adjusting the mesh piece to accommodate the way you want Iffo to look. So for example, pull the vertices out at the shoulder area and thicken up the arms a tad.

It's a 'fiddly' job and you're restricted to how far you can go due to JKA horrible skeleton. As you know, I'm willing to help you when needed matey!
